              Have fun on the test drive/break in run. Check out the PCM manual as you have to run certain RPM's for specific times to get the rings to seat properly. Don't be surprised if you get the burning paint smell as the motor gets really warm for the first time. Another cool thing to try is while the boat is at crusing speed, let go of the wheel and see how true she tracks. Bet you she's spot on! It says alot about CC and how well engineered their boats are. Can't say that for the competition.
